The Strand between 19th st & 25th st is where the majority of the vendors are.  Also are a bunch of places to eat.  To actually ride your bike thru and park within that area is about $10.00 per bike.  There is plenty of parking to be found around and out of that section and is still close to vendors, food, music, saggy boobs and day-off stripper. 

The Seawall between 21st & 24th will usually also have vendors and a stage setup for music.  Little food unless you hit a local restaurant nearby. 


These are the two hotspots on the Island for biker fun.

As said above, the main action is on The Strand.  Vendors are set up on the numbered side streets from about 19 through 25th streets, and across Harborside Drive.  Your best bet for parking is to drive down Broadway all the way to about 14th street or so, turn left and go down to the Strand.  Start looking for a place to park on one of the side streets and walk up from there.  The earlier you get there the better.  IMO, it's not worth it to pay the money to ride down the Strand.  It's supposed to be a parking fee, but you AIN'T gonna find a spot to park in there.  Once you're parked, you can walk around and see the sights.  There will be plenty of bikes to look at, but you really shouldn't discount the boobs!  During the day it's pretty family friendly.  More boobs come out at night.  Where are you coming from?
